The time it takes to fly from Los Angeles to New York varies inversely as the speed of the plane. If the trip takes 6 hours at 900 km/h, how long would it take at 800 km/h?

Answers

It would take approximately 6.75 hours to fly from Los Angeles to New York at a speed of 800 km/h.

To solve this problem, we can use the concept of inverse variation. Inverse variation means that as one variable increases, the other variable decreases proportionally.

Let's denote the time it takes to fly from Los Angeles to New York as "t" (in hours) and the speed of the plane as "s" (in km/h).

According to the problem, the time and speed vary inversely. This can be expressed mathematically as:

t = k/s

where "k" is a constant of variation.

To find the value of "k," we can use the given information that the trip takes 6 hours at 900 km/h:

6 = k/900

To solve for "k," we can multiply both sides of the equation by 900:

6 * 900 = k

k = 5400

Now that we have the value of "k," we can use it to find the time it would take at 800 km/h:

t = 5400/800

t ≈ 6.75 hours

J = K (1+ p/100) make p as a subject

Answers

Answer:

p = 100(J/K - 1)

Step-by-step explanation:

When we want to make a variable the subject of an equation, we want to get that variable by itself on one side of the equation - to unwrap it from all the operations attached to it.

Here's what the process looks like for p:

\(J=K(1+p/100)\\J/K=1+p/100\\J/K-1=p/100\\p=100(J/K-1)\)
